2. INSPECT HYBRID TRANSAXLE FLUID
Pre-procedure1
(a) Remove the filler plug and gasket from the hybrid Toyota Prius vehicle transaxle assembly. |
|
Procedure1
(b) for PA10: (1) Check that the hybrid transaxle fluid level is between 0 to 6 mm (0 to 0.236 in.) from the bottom lip of the filler plug opening. NOTICE:
|
|
(c) for PB10, PB12:
(1) Check that the hybrid transaxle fluid level is between 0 to 10 mm (0 to 0.394 in.) from the bottom lip of the filler plug opening.
NOTICE:
Post-procedure1
(d) Check for leaks if the hybrid transaxle fluid level is low. (If there are no hybrid transaxle fluid leaks but the hybrid transaxle fluid level is low, add hybrid transaxle fluid.)
HINT:
Click here
(e) Install the filler plug and a new gasket to the hybrid Toyota Prius vehicle transaxle assembly.
Torque:
50 N·m {510 kgf·cm, 37 ft·lbf}

2. DRAIN HYBRID TRANSAXLE FLUID
(a) Remove the filler plug and gasket from the hybrid Toyota Prius vehicle transaxle assembly. |
|
(b) Using a 10 mm hexagon socket wrench, remove the drain plug and gasket from the hybrid Toyota Prius vehicle transaxle assembly and drain the hybrid transaxle fluid. |
|
(c) Using a 10 mm hexagon socket wrench, install the drain plug and a new gasket to the hybrid Toyota Prius vehicle transaxle assembly.
Torque:
50 N·m {510 kgf·cm, 37 ft·lbf}
(d) Temporarily install the filler plug and gasket to the hybrid vehicle transaxle assembly.
HINT:
Reuse the old gasket as the filler plug will be removed again.
3. ADD HYBRID TRANSAXLE FLUID
(a) Remove the filler plug and gasket from the hybrid Toyota Prius vehicle transaxle assembly. |
|
(b) for PA10:
(1) Add hybrid transaxle fluid until the hybrid transaxle fluid level is between 0 to 6 mm (0 to 0.236 in.) from the bottom lip of the filler plug opening. [#]
Hybrid Transaxle Fluid Standard Capacity (for Reference):
3.0 liters (3.2 US qts, 2.6 Imp. qts)
NOTICE:
Using hybrid transaxle fluid other than the above type may cause abnormal noise or vibration, or ultimately damage the transaxle of the vehicle.
(2) After adding hybrid transaxle fluid, leave the vehicle for 30 seconds so that the hybrid transaxle fluid surface can become still again, and then check that the hybrid transaxle fluid level is between 0 to 6 mm (0 to 0.236 in.) from the bottom lip of the filler plug opening. (If the hybrid transaxle fluid level is low, repeat this procedure from step [#].)
NOTICE:
After adding hybrid transaxle fluid, make sure to check the hybrid transaxle fluid level.
(c) for PB10:
(1) Add hybrid transaxle fluid until the hybrid transaxle fluid level is between 0 to 10 mm (0 to 0.394 in.) from the bottom lip of the filler plug opening. [#]
Hybrid Transaxle Fluid Standard Capacity (for Reference):
3.7 liters (3.9 US qts, 3.3 Imp. qts)
NOTICE:
Using hybrid transaxle fluid other than the above type may cause abnormal noise or vibration, or ultimately damage the transaxle of the vehicle.
(2) After adding hybrid transaxle fluid, leave the vehicle for 30 seconds so that the hybrid transaxle fluid surface can become still again, and then check that the hybrid transaxle fluid level is between 0 to 10 mm (0 to 0.394 in.) from the bottom lip of the filler plug opening. (If the hybrid transaxle fluid level is low, repeat this procedure from step [#].)
NOTICE:
After adding hybrid transaxle fluid, make sure to check the hybrid transaxle fluid level.
(d) Temporarily install the filler plug and gasket to the hybrid Toyota Prius vehicle transaxle assembly.
HINT:
Reuse the old gasket as the filler plug will be removed again.
